Because he won a gold medal & Bob Arum promoted him. Arum paid off the WBC to get him ranked for a title shot if he defeated some bum. Ali turned down the fight initially but after seeing Spinks struggle against the bum, he figured since he beat Patterson, and Frazier he'd go for three gold medal winners and fight Spinks. Ali was old, didn't take the fight serious, and didn't train hard.Comment
